The repair itself
A dripping head is usually a blocked drain, and a musty smell is usually a fouled blower wheel — both are cleanings, not replacements.
If it's time for new equipment
Installations are properly evacuated, weighed in and commissioned. Ductless done quickly and ductless done right look identical on day one and very different in year three.
